BEIJING: The First Session of the 11th National Committee of the Chinese People’s Political Consultative Conference (CPPCC) concluded on Friday, adopting resolutions and stressing the leadership of the Communist Party of China (CPC) over the CPPCC. Jia Qinglin, who was re-elected Chairman of the CPPCC National Committee, presided over the closing meeting. Mr. Jia urged political advisers to adhere to the two main themes of unity and democracy and “unite all forces that can be united” to contribute to the building of a prosperous society. CPC and state leaders Hu Jintao, Wu Bangguo, Wen Jiabao, Zeng Qinghong, Li Changchun and others attended the opening and closing sessions. A political resolution adopted at the closing meeting hailed China’s development over the past five years, saying the CPC Central Committee — with Mr. Hu as general secretary — had led people of all ethnic groups in advancing reform, opening up and modernisation. — Xinhua
